Chrome plating is widely applied across various industries due to its excellent corrosion resistance, hardness, and low friction properties. In the aerospace and automotive sectors, it enhances durability and performance in critical components like aircraft parts and engine components. Chrome plating is also used in industrial machinery to increase wear resistance and reduce friction in gears, shafts, and rollers. Additionally, it is employed in the printing industry to maintain print quality by protecting copper plates and cylinders from wear and corrosion. Its use extends to oil exploration, hydraulic systems, medical devices, and food processing equipment, where it provides protection against corrosion and facilitates easy cleaning. Furthermore, chrome plating is valued for its aesthetic appeal in decorative applications such as kitchenware, sanitaryware, and jewelry.

Production Process of Chrome Plating

The extensive Chrome Plating production cost report consists of the following major industrial production process:

  • Production via a multi-step process: The production process of Chrome plating initiates with surface preparation, where the metal is cleaned to remove impurities, which ensures better adhesion of the chromium layer. In the next step, the part is submerged in an activation bath to create a microscopic texture that enhances bonding. After that, a nickel base layer is then applied through electroplating to improve smoothness and corrosion resistance. The part is then immersed in a chromium bath, where an electric current causes chromium ions to bond to the surface to form a uniform layer. After plating, the item is rinsed, dried, and polished to achieve the desired finish. In the final step, a thorough inspection and quality control check is conducted to ensure the plating meets standards, with parts that pass being ready for use or further processing.

Properties of Chrome Plating

Chrome plating is extremely hard, with a hardness measured between 65-70 HRc (940-1210 HV), which makes it highly resistant to wear and abrasion. It also has a low coefficient of friction, which reduces friction between moving parts and enhances the lifespan of equipment. Chrome plating has a coefficient of linear thermal expansion of 8.1 x 10^-6 cm/cm/ degree Celsius, which is lower than many metals, reducing the risk of thermal stress. Chrome plating has excellent corrosion resistance against various corrosive environments, such as acids and salts, though it may not be suitable for all chemicals like hydrochloric acid. Additionally, chrome plating is easy to clean and maintain, which makes it ideal for applications requiring hygiene and durability.
